. Rental car prices were not as good as I had hoped, so we opted to go with Silvercar for this trip. Joe rented from them when flying to Dallas for his job interviews and fell in love. They only have one kind of car, a silver Audi A4.
They pick you up right at the airport and take you to your car and it's all done right on their convenient app. Best part was it was only 30 dollars more to go with them than an economy car through any of the other guys.
